Dubai Frame

A viewpoint where the frame cleverly puts you in place for a memorable picture. You can actually stand on the viewing platform and click an image that reflects both the old and new Dubai. On one side is the the old district of Deira with its narrow streets and wooden wind towers. While on the other side, snap the architectural marvels of Burj Khalifa and Downtown Dubai. The Dubai Frame now becomes part of your photo, and your photo tells even more of a story.

Al Fahidi Historical Neighbourhood

Take a journey into the past within these narrow lanes home to the traditional mudbrick homes. Document the architectural intricacies of these age-old buildings, quite a contrast to the recent city. Head to Dubai Creek, which has been the center of life in Dubai for hundreds of years. Take pictures of the old dhows lining the shore, their worn hulls speaking of days gone by. At each of these stopovers, you can dive into the lap of Dubai’s golden past and freeze moments that speak tales of age-old history and time-abled traditions.

MADINAT JUMEIRAH

Wander through a maze of sand-colored walls and palm-lined walkways at Madinat Jumeirah. It’s part of a sprawling complex containing no fewer than five luxury hotels, three villa properties, and 40 restaurants and bars. Witness the majestic layouts as you sit back and enjoy the free-end Abra boat ride over the waterways. Take a photo of the Burj Al Arab’s sail-shaped silhouette jutting from the cyan waters — an emblem of Dubai’s bold personality. Dubai Desert Conservation Reserve

Get out of the city and experience a huge contrast to this stark landscape one finds in the Arabian Desert. This is where you can take pictures in wide, unobstructed rolling sand dunes bathed in golden sunshine at sunset. Early risers are rewarded with the silence of the desert and the majestic silhouette of the oryx flock. A visit to the Dubai Desert Conservation Reserve allows for a respite from urban living, showcasing landscapes bubbling in their untamed glory.

Alserkal Avenue

Visit the recalibrated industrial district turned culture village for an atypical photo adventure. Document street art murals on the sides of warehouses versus galleries with contemporary art inside. Shoot a sculpture in the open courtyard or details of an installation piece. Alserkal Avenue gives you a window into Dubai’s booming contemporary art scene, enabling you to arrest the city’s creative spirit.

Hatta Waterfalls

Drive through the desert heat into a secret paradise- the Hatta Waterfalls. Tucked in the rugged Hajar Mountains, these falls encourage a refreshing getaway. Sink into the contrast of arid rock and natural succulence, a juxtaposition between the pools and cliffs. You could take pictures of families on their picnic on the banks of the river, or children playing in the water of the river to cool off. Hatta Waterfalls- Hatta Waterfalls are a surprise find in the desert landscape and a beautiful place to photograph.
